Strange temps question

Hi internet land

 

Pc specs:

mobo: Asus ranger VII

cpu: I-5 4690 oc-4.1Ghz

gpu: R9 290 oc- 1140Mhz

8 gig ram

samsung SSD boot drive

 

Cpu/Gpu custom water-cooled loop with a single 280x60mm radiator ( planning on installing a second of the rad soon once i've build the case for it)

 

 

when i leave my pc to idle and eventually going into sleep mode (monitors turning off whilst the tower stays active) the temps on my Gpu climb to 50-55 degrees

(normal idle about 27-33 degrees), I normally see 50-55 degrees when it's under heavy gaming load.

 

 Hopefully someone is able give me some insight whats going on?
